Online gaming milestone

Shadowrun is a game that really isn't anything special. It was essentially just your average run of the mill shooter. In fact, it was actually a big disappointment to most people.

One thing that made Shadowrun stand out was the ability to have Xbox360 users compete with or against Windows Vista users. This is revolutionary because for the first time, a game can be played on line across two gaming platforms simultaneously. For example in a death match you could have 4 xbox users going up against 4 windows users.
